A Professional Certificate in Reindeer Reproduction provides specialized training in the reproductive biology and management of reindeer (Rangifer tarandus). This intensive program equips participants with the knowledge and skills crucial for successful reindeer breeding programs, herd management, and conservation efforts.
Learning outcomes encompass a thorough understanding of reindeer reproductive physiology, including estrous cycles, breeding techniques, pregnancy diagnosis, and parturition management. Students will gain practical experience in artificial insemination (AI), semen collection and evaluation, and the management of reindeer health during pregnancy and lactation. Advanced topics such as genetic improvement and cryopreservation techniques might also be covered.
The duration of the certificate program typically varies depending on the institution, ranging from several weeks to several months, often combining online modules with intensive practical sessions. This flexible approach allows professionals already working with reindeer to integrate the program into their existing schedules.
